Free garden parking with accessible bays, seasonal overflow, and direct access to Beth Chattos Gardens.
Beth Chattos Car Park is a private lot dedicated to visitors of Beth Chattos Plants & Gardens, located off Clacton Road in Elmstead Market. The site features 100 sealed gravel bays, including six accessible spaces situated directly adjacent to the main visitor entrance and gift shop. Parking is free of charge for garden patrons; overflow is managed by overflow signage and staff direction during peak season (AprilSeptember). Solar-powered LED bollard lights line the pedestrian walkway from dusk until 8:00 pm, ensuring safe egress. One CCTV camera monitors the entrance and accessible bays for security. Covered information boards at the entrance display garden opening hours, tour schedules, and local bus timetables for the No. 71 service to Colchester. Pedestrian pathways lead directly to the Tearoom and Display Gardens within a two-minute walk. Monthly maintenance includes gravel replenishment, line repainting, and litter collection to maintain the serene, horticultural environment.
